What happens after weeks of sleeplessness and being overworked beyond exhaustian.
Breakdown

Staring eyes,
Racing heart,
Giddiness unleashed.
Smiling faces,
Raised eyebrows,
Breathe
Slow
Breathe
Deep
Relax…
Relax…
Close the eyes,
See the blackness
Turn to rainbows.
Giggles, giggles!
Breathe
Slow
Breathe
Deep
Tension, twitching, ticking,
Rising…
Rising…
Rising…
Peaking.
Tears roll down the face
Control yourself!
How?
Shaking, crying, sobbing…
Take deep breaths.
Wracking sobs
Tear the throat,
Burn the eyes,
Smudge the images,
Blur the lines.
Lay softly in the dark,
Sing a quiet tune…
“And all will turn to silver glass…”
Breathe
Slow
Breathe
Deep
Reality falls away.
Open the eyes,
Searing and red,
Dry the tearstains
On the cheeks
Calming…
Calming…
Calming…
Finished.



[Line 37: Source: "Into the West" sung by Annie Lennox; The Lord of the Rings: The Return of the King soundtrack.]
